GitLab OAuth for Batch Changes
A more secure credentials mechanism for Batch Changes in GitLab.

A more secure credentials mechanism for Batch Changes in GitLab.
Sourcegraph now supports OAuth credentials for GitLab in Batch Changes. Previously, only API keys were supported.
Once a Sourcegraph administrator has set up a GitLab app for their instance, and configured this as an authentication provider in Sourcegraph, users can authenticate through this GitLab app in their Batch Change credential settings.
You can migrate from previous API keys to OAuth for Gitlab by deleting the credential from your Batch Change credentials setting, and then create a new credential where you select OAuth.
Support for OAuth with GitHub is already available through GitHub apps. Let us know if you would like to see other code hosts support OAuth for Batch Changes.